HOUSE NATURAL RESOURCES COMMITTEE APPROVES GOLEZ RESOLUTION URGING SUSPENSION OF COMMERCIAL LOGGING:

The House Committee on Natural Resources approved yesterday a House Resolution authored by Cong. Roilo Golez (2d District, Paranaque City) urging Malacanang and the DENR to suspend all commercial logging operations in view of the damage to lives and property brought about by flashflood and mudslides caused by denuded mountains and forests in Aurora and Quezon. The resolution was approved unanimously by the members of the committee headed by Congressman Leovigildo Banaag of Agusan del Norte. This is considered historic because it is the first time in the history of the House of Representatives that a commercial log ban resolution has been approved at committee level. The log ban issue has always been a contentious and hot issue in the House of Representatives.
